Back pain is one of the foremost common illnesses that plague mankind for hundreds of years. There are several causes of back pain and lower back pain.

Causes of Back Pain

The more common reason for having a painful back is usually muscle strain. A lot of people put too much stress or strain on their back muscles and they get damaged or injured pretty much the same way that muscles get sore when lifting a lot of weight. Back pain that is caused by muscle strain can often be treated by just taking it easy for a few days and not over exerting the back muscles. Taking pain relievers and muscle relaxants can also help to alleviate the soreness and the pain associated with back pain because of muscle strain. Muscle strain can also benefit from the use of warm compresses and also deep tissue massages.

Stress is another cause of back pain. When a person is feeling nervous and stressed out, chances are his or her muscles feel tight and wound up. The back will be affected by this reaction to stress. Massages and calming down sufficiently is the treatment for this kind of back pain. Aromatherapy is also another good solution to treat this type of pain as well as other pains which may have arisen due to mental stress.

Another probable reason for back pain can be damage to the spine. A pinched nerve or damaged spinal disc is a few of the major reasons of back pain in people. A consultation with a doctor might be important to see if the patient is really being affected by these illnesses or something else. It might be difficult to self diagnose these conditions since the patient will require the help of a doctor.

Other reasons for back pain may be organs that are malfunctioning such as the gall bladder and the kidneys. Although these organs are found deeper than muscles, people feel the pain through the back when these organs are going through some condition or have been damaged. A visit to the doctor could be important if you know that you have sustained and injury that may have affected these organs or other vital organs resulting to back pain. Treating back pain is dependent on what caused the pain in the first place. Seek advice from a specialist before trying out medications which may be wrong for the condition.
